Education

Desiring to provide its members with the best preparation for a rewarding career in the electrical industry, IAEI has designed a program of education that is far-reaching, thorough, and authoritative. 

Seminars are offered at the international office, on-site at various corporations and municipalities, and jointly with various sections, chapters, and divisions. Subjects include grounding and bonding, hazardous locations, one- and two-family dwelling, residential inspections, commercial inspections, neon lighting, health care facilities, analysis of code changes, and other topics upon request.

IAEI books are among the best on the market for thoroughly presenting all facets of a given topic. In addition to regular texts, several study guides are tailored to help members pass the various tests required for advancement in his or her career. Code books and other electrical books that have been thoroughly screened for compliance to the codes are also offered.

IAEI News, recognized as the premier publication in the electrical field, always contains articles that are relevant to many of the situations that arise daily for AHJs and installers. It also contains pertinent information on sections, chapters, and divisions as well as member activities.

IAEI's training materials--in both PowerPoint and slide formats--are highly sought out and eagerly awaited. These materials are prepared for each book and seminar and graphically portray each situation discussed.

Each of the above educational opportunities is offered to members at discounted prices.


Industry Benefits

Electrical safety has always been the main goal of IAEI and its focus has been to insist that every person in the industry do everything possible to ensure that safety. Consequently, the association has insisted that its greatest benefit to its members is a focus on seven simple actions.

  • Assist in writing and evaluating standards

  • Teach unvarying application of codes

  • Lobby for equable rules and inspection methods

  • Publish articles and books on safe installations

  • Support inspectors' interests to manufacturers, labs, and contractors

  • Work to further develop the industry

  • Urge cooperation among inspectors, government, industry and public

Certification in Electrical Inspections

Two excellent certification programs have been developed:

National Certification Program for Construction Code Inspectors (NCPCCI)
Developed by national code enforcement organizations in collaboration with Thomson Prometric, this testing program provides nationally recognized evidence of competence and professionalism in construction code knowledge. This is particularly useful to inspectors and plan reviewers.

IAEI Certified Electrical Inspector (CEI) Program
This program focuses on two areas: CEI Residential and CEI Master. Its objective is to enhance performance in the use and application of the National Electrical Code and to promote professionalism within the electrical inspector field. Benefits of this program include:

  • Certification by IAEI, the most recognized  international organization in the electrical inspection industry
  • Professional recognition through listing in the International Registry of Certified Electrical Inspectors
  • Demonstrated competence and knowledge in electrical inspections
  • Advancement in your career
